Safety
Despite their popularity, bunk beds are often associated with a danger, especially for children. Every year, thousands of children are hospitalized for injuries resulting from the use of loft beds and bunk beds. Most of these injuries are not serious. The most common incidents involving bunk beds occur when kids play on or around their beds, and a significant percentage of them involve falling off the top bunk. There are a variety of ways to minimize the risk and ensure your children's safety at night.
First of all, you should select a bunk bed that is in compliance with all safety standards. Guardrails should extend at a minimum of 3.5" on both sides of the bed and be properly fixed to prevent children from falling. The upper guardrails should be at least five inches above the mattress to protect against falls. The ladder should also be firmly and securely attached to the frame of the bunk. Steps for the ladder must be made from durable materials with wide, secure treads to prevent sliding. From the beginning, you should teach your children to use bunk beds properly. This includes not playing on or around the bunk beds, and sleeping only in them, and keeping your belongings and body within the guardrails.
Other measures that are easy to take can lessen the chance of bunk bed accidents. This includes ensuring that the ladder is not used as a climbing framework and that no belts or ropes have been attached to the beds. These could pose an injury to strangulation. You should also make sure the ladder is located away from light fixtures and ceiling fans to reduce the chance of crashing into them when climbing up and down. Additionally, you should regularly examine the bunk bed for signs of wear and tear, in particular any squeaks which could indicate loose or compromised components that could compromise stability or safety.
Beware of DIY or do-it-yourself bunk beds kits that may not comply with the latest safety standards. Always consult the manufacturer's guidelines when buying a new bunk bed, and ask about any additional safety features they may offer.
Space
A mid bunk bed is lower in height than the loft bed or high sleeper. This means that the space below can be used to store things or even as a bed. This is a great option for smaller rooms or children who require more sleeping or study space.
There's usually the space for a desk or bookcase, on the bed's side. This is great for storage and homework. Certain models will come with a low-height wardrobe that's ideal for kids' clothing and other models have cubbies for toys, books and bits and pieces.
The most comfortable mid-bunk beds will also have a staircase leading to the loft for sleeping. This eliminates the need for ladders, and makes it easier for kids to get in and out of the bed. They might also have an open window that provides a sense of surprise to the space and creates the illusion of your own personal retreat.
Some models also have an ottoman or pull-out couch, which creates a comfortable space for watching movies with the family and socializing. Others will have a workstation that can be turned down, which is great for kids who have to stay focused on their homework and schoolwork.

Storage
A mid bunk bed is a great option for kids who like to design their sleeping spaces. They are often equipped with storage solutions integrated into them which maximize the space under and helping to keep it clutter-free. Additionally, they come with curtains and play tents that add character.
Drawers: They help reduce clutter by providing a spot for toys, clothes, or bedding that can be put under the bed. These are ideal for small rooms with limited closet space, or for families with several children sharing the same bedroom. Stairs: For an extra degree of security the bunk beds can be fitted with stairs that are built into the side of the structure. They're a great alternative to traditional ladders, and have an ergonomic design that is easier for children to use.
Trundles: These are perfect to accommodate guests at family gatherings and vacation homes. They can be rolled out from under the bottom bunk when needed and seamlessly tuck away when not in use.
Desk A pull-out desk is a great option for teens and teens because it offers a convenient space for projects or homework. If they decorate it with the use of bean bags and lights or choose modern design it's an excellent way to encourage independent study and increase their productivity.
Think about a bunk bed with a media center if your children prefer to sit in front of the television. This innovative feature comes with a built-in TV stand and drawers for storing DVDs and other entertainment.
